As an Area Chef, you will:
- Champion food quality, presentation, and safety standards across your kitchens.
- Coach and mentor Head Chefs, building loyal, high-performing teams.
- Lead pre-refit preparations, ensuring kitchens are ready for reopening success.
- Provide hands-on support during VIP nights, opening launches, and post-refit trading.
- Deliver inspiring training to upskill existing teams and onboard new chefs.
- Drive compliance and best practice in food hygiene, safety, and operations.
- Collaborate closely with the Food Director and operations leaders to ensure consistency and excellence.
Proven expertise in kitchen operations, food safety, and compliance. Excellent training and coaching skills - with a focus on hands-on leadership. Strong organisational skills to manage multiple projects across the UK. Clear communicator, able to inspire and connect with both BOH and FOH teams. Passion for Italian cuisine, food quality, and operational excellence. A full UK driving licence and willingness to travel extensively.
